The invention relates to the field of cast-in-place construction equipment for civil construction, and particularly relates to a triangular reinforcing member structure for mounting a cast-in-place concrete beam formwork and a mounting method. The triangular reinforcing member structure is simpler and more convenient to mount, lower in cost and better in forming effect. The triangular reinforcing member structure comprises at least two formwork mounting reinforcing members composed of triangular reinforcing main members, height adjusting members and fasteners, wherein the formwork mounting reinforcing members are fixedly arranged on a frame body through the fasteners, and the concrete beam formwork is arranged between the formwork mounting reinforcing members in a closely attached mode. According to the triangular reinforcing member structure for mounting the cast-in-place concrete beam formwork and the mounting method, the engineering cost can be reduced, the construction period can be shortened, and meanwhile the appearance quality of concrete is greatly improved. The formwork mounting reinforcing members fully utilize effective combination of the stability of the triangles of the reinforcing members and the frame body, and the effect of quickly reinforcing the cast-in-place concrete beam formwork is achieved with fewer turnover materials. The triangular reinforcing member structure for mounting the cast-in-place concrete beam formwork and the mounting method are particularly suitable for the pouring occasion that the height range of a cast-in-place concrete beam is 600-1000mm.
